  • Abstract
    This article summarizes the state of the art of transformer modeling for the study of electromagnetic transients. It clearly describes the scope and limitations of the available transformer models for the low- and mid-frequency ranges. it also discusses about the duality-based viewpoint, the physical meaning of the dual Cauer model used to represent the nonlinear iron core.
